在这个数字化时代,通信技术的发展日新月异,而SIP(Session Initiation Protocol)协议无疑是其中的佼佼者,SIP协议是一种用于创建、修改和终止多媒体会话的信令协议,它在互联网上为各种通信应用提供了基础,从视频会议到VoIP电话,SIP的身影无处不在,但它究竟如何运作,又如何影响我们的日常生活呢?
想象一下,你正在通过SIP协议与朋友进行视频通话,当你拨通电话的那一刻,SIP就像是一个指挥官,它会告诉你“准备好,我们开始建立联系了!”SIP会发送一个信令,告知对方你想要建立一个会话,这个信令就像是一个邀请,告诉对方你想要开始通话,SIP会发送一系列的信令,包括你的电话号码、地址和你希望的通话参数,这些信息就像是你和朋友之间的沟通,确保通话的质量和稳定性。
SIP协议的结构简单明了,它由一系列的消息组成,每个消息都有自己的目的,INVITE消息用于请求建立会话,ACK消息用于确认收到INVITE消息,BYE消息用于终止会话,这些消息就像是电话中的按键,每个都有特定的用途,当你按下“邀请”键时,SIP就会知道你想开始一个通话;当你按下“结束”键时,SIP就会知道你想结束通话。
SIP的灵活性也值得一提,它可以根据不同的应用场景调整协议,比如在不同的网络环境下调整信令的发送和接收方式,这就像是一辆车,你可以根据路况和天气调整行驶速度和路线,在拥堵的城市道路上,你可能会选择步行或骑自行车;在开阔的乡村道路上,你可能会选择开车,SIP协议也是如此,它会根据不同的网络环境选择最合适的通信方式。
SIP协议的普及也带来了许多好处,它降低了通信成本,因为SIP通常使用标准的IP网络进行通信,这意味着不需要额外的硬件设施,SIP支持多种媒体类型,包括语音、视频和数据,这使得它非常适合构建各种通信应用,SIP的开放性意味着它易于扩展和集成,开发者可以轻松地在现有系统中添加新的功能。
尽管SIP协议有着诸多优点,但它也面临着一些挑战,SIP协议的安全性问题一直是研究的热点,由于SIP消息通常会暴露在公共网络上,这就为攻击者提供了可乘之机,为了应对这一问题,SIP协议引入了加密和认证机制,以保护通信内容不被未授权访问。
SIP协议是通信世界中的一个基石,它简单、灵活、高效,为各种通信应用提供了基础,无论是在商业会议中还是在家庭聚会中,SIP协议都在默默地工作,确保我们的沟通畅通无阻,随着技术的不断进步,我们有理由相信,SIP协议将继续在通信领域发挥着不可或缺的作用。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。
评论